Mass of the solid residue after hydrolysis [g] and glucose yield in the hydrolysates [%] (reaction conditions: T = 140 °C, t = 2 h, cacid = 2%).
| Designation of samples | Mass of sample [g] | Mass of cotton in the 1 g of samplea [g] | Mass of cotton in the sample [g] | Mass of the solid residue [g] | Mass of Cu in solid residueb [g] | Mass of the cotton in the solid residue [g] | Loss of cotton weight [g] | Glucose concentrationc [g L−1] | Glucose yield from 1 gram of sample [g] | Glucose yield [%] |
|---|---|---|---|---|---|---|---|---|---|---|
| 1 | 1.062 | 0.998 | 1.060 | 0.952 | 0.007 | 0.945 | 0.115 | 5.70 | 0.114 | 99.24 |
| 2 | 0.989 | 0.764 | 0.756 | 0.811 | 0.199 | 0.612 | 0.144 | 4.15 | 0.083 | 57.80 |
| 3 | 1.077 | 0.998 | 1.075 | 0.840 | 0.009 | 0.831 | 0.244 | 11.98 | 0.240 | 98.26 |
| 4 | 0.994 | 0.764 | 0.759 | 0.779 | 0.295 | 0.484 | 0.275 | 13.31 | 0.266 | 96.65 |
Cu% – wt in CO sample from ICP measurement = 0.02% (for 1 g sample of CO mCu = 0.002 g); Cu% – wt in CO/Cu sample from ICP measurement = 23.64% (for 1 g sample of CO/Cu mCu = 0.236 g).
Calculated on the basted of the data listed in Table 7.
Concentration of glucose in hydrolysates determined by HPLC measurements.
